Here I show the full record on trimming wheel-thrown plates and bowls on the pottery wheel and decorating plates and bowls. From this ASMR video, you can see how I trim and decorate pots and it may help you learn how to treat the wheel-thrown pottery at this stage. You may simply find this video relaxing. I feel relaxed sitting beside wheels, trimming off excessive clay, and taking a break from making large sculptures. I hope you enjoy it as well.
